Medical negligence cases are often complicated and require difficult witnesses. Teams of lawyers are on the side of hospitals, doctors and insurance companies who are trained to cut or eliminate payments. It is important to find a lawyer who can take on these powerful opponents.

A medical malpractice lawsuit has four parts: duty, breach, causation, and damages. An experienced birth injury lawyer will assist you to gather evidence and create strong legal arguments to support each of these elements.

In a birth injury case, the obligation is to prove that your doctor had an professional relationship with you. This could be done by using medical records or hospital invoices. The next step is to prove that you were owed an obligation by your doctor to exercise the competence and professionalism by a medical professional.

Birth Injury

A birth injury attorney can assist a family in filing an action for medical negligence against the hospital or doctor that acted in negligence during labor and delivery. A successful legal action may result in financial compensation to help families pay for their child's future and current medical expenses, lost wages and emotional trauma.

A experienced birth injury lawyer will know how to go through the medical records of your child and identify any possible acts of negligence and hire experts (often other OB/GYN physicians) to look over the case and provide an opinion on the degree of malpractice that occurred. After the experts have reviewed the case, your lawyer can determine who is responsible for the injuries. They will then identify the defendants.

In the majority of states, including New York, there is an expiration date for filing an injury claim with the court, known as the statute of limitations. For birth injury claims, this usually is 30 months or two and two and a half (2-1/2) years after the medical malpractice occurred.

During this period your attorney will negotiate with your insurance company to negotiate an agreement on your behalf. Your attorney will file a lawsuit in the appropriate court in the event that the insurance company is unwilling to pay a reasonable amount. A judge and jury will then make a decision. This is a complex process that should only be handled by an experienced professional.
